Vodka is often misunderstood as merely a neutral spirit, yet it represents a sophisticated intersection of agricultural science and precision engineering. At its core, vodka is defined by its pursuit of purity, derived from the systematic fermentation and distillation of fermentable sugars. Whether the source material is grain, potato, grape, or molasses, the fundamental objective remains the same: extracting ethanol while meticulously managing the congeners—the volatile compounds that provide flavor and aroma. The structural integrity of a premium vodka is governed by the quality of the raw material, which introduces subtle textural and aromatic nuances, often overlooked by the untrained palate.
The transition from raw distillate to a refined, high-end spirit relies on rigorous technical interventions. Modern production favors column distillation, a process that allows for continuous refinement and the precise isolation of ethanol. This stage is followed by advanced filtration techniques. Traditional charcoal filtration is frequently employed for its efficacy in removing impurities, while contemporary methods may utilize crushed quartz, garnet, or silver, each contributing to a distinct mouthfeel. It is this balance between the efficiency of distillation and the artistry of filtration that dictates the ultimate character and texture of the final liquid.
International standards for classifying vodka are nuanced and require expertise to navigate. While definitions can vary by jurisdiction, the industry generally categorizes vodka based on flavor profile, raw material origin, and production method. Connoisseurs distinguish between traditional neutral styles, which prioritize pristine cleanliness and structural fluidity, and craft expressions that intentionally retain trace characteristics of the base material. This distinction is critical for those seeking to match the spirit to specific culinary or cocktail applications.
Within professional bar environments, terminology is essential for defining the service of vodka. Experts distinguish between sipping vodka, which requires a specific temperature profile to unlock its viscous, clean qualities, and mixing vodka, designed to provide a structural backbone to cocktails without interfering with the profile of modifiers. Understanding the impact of temperature—specifically the suppression of ethanol burn through controlled chilling—is a fundamental skill that separates novice enjoyment from professional appreciation.
